DRUIDS’ LODGE
BUSINESS AT FORTNIGHTLY. MEETING.
At the last fortnightly meeting of the Masterton Druids’ Lodge, held in the Foresters Hall, the A.D. Bro F. Gray presided over a good attendance of members. ' Bro F. B. Pickering reported on a recent meeting of the United Friendly Societies’ Dispensary Board. The secretary reported that ten brethren had declared on the sick benefit of the lodge, and sick pay and accounts amounting to £77 19s lid were passed. The A.D. extended a welcome to several ola members for their -attendance and hoped that they would continue to show an interest in the lodge. During the evening a presentation was made to the A.D. Bro F. Gray, who was recently married. In making the presentation Bro F. B. Pickering referred to the loyal service that Bro Gray had rendered to the lodge, and on behalf of the officers and brethren, he wished both Mr and Mrs Gray every happiness in the future. At the conclusion of lodge business an enjoyable social evening was held.
